The Art of Consistency: Navigating Life's Thousand Molehills

No matter how talented, motivated, or visionary you are, your ability to do whatever it is you want to do consistently is the secret sauce of life. But what does consistency really mean? And what do most people get wrong about the connection between consistency and success?

Many people equate consistency with success. They think it's about conquering one big challenge, one large mountain.

But life isn't a single mountain; it's a series of molehills. There are also natural peaks and valleys that we all experience as humans. The real key to success lies in taking slow, small, steady steps over these molehills. It's not a sprint; it's a marathon of mindful actions.

Key Points

  • The Mindset Shift Consistency isn't just about discipline; it's about creating an environment where discipline becomes the default. Simplify the process, remove the complexities, and make it as easy as flipping a switch to get started.
  • The Power of Little Things Remember, how you do little things is how you do all things. It's about laying one brick at a time to build that wall. It's about the accumulation of small, consistent actions that lead to significant results.
  • Small Steps > Grand Gestures Consistency is not about grand gestures or monumental tasks. It's about the daily grind, the small steps you take every day that lead you to your ultimate goal. So, the next time you find yourself struggling with consistency, remember: it's not about the mountain; it's about the molehills.

If You're Struggling with Consistency

It's crucial to ask yourself some hard-hitting questions, in two different categories:

Your Priorities

  • What Matters Most?: Identify the key areas in your life that require consistent effort.
  • Why Does It Matter?: Understand the deeper reasons behind your goals.
  • What's the Endgame?: Visualize what success looks like for you.

Your Actions

  • What's Holding You Back?: Is it fear, lack of knowledge, or perhaps a lack of enjoyment?
  • How Can You Simplify?: Identify the smallest, simplest actions that can move you toward your goals.
  • Who or What Can Hold You Accountable?: Find a mentor, tracking system, or community that can help you stay on track.

How to Get Started

  • Visualize: Create a vision board or write down your goals and why they matter. Keep it somewhere you'll see it every day.
  • Plan: Break down your big goals into smaller, manageable tasks. Schedule them.
  • Execute and Adjust: Start executing your plan. If something isn't working, adjust but don't quit.
